Abstract

Current study focus on proposing a model to capture personal solid waste management behavior of Colombo District consumers in Sri Lanka. The model was developed based on the theory of planned behavior proposed by Ajzen (1991) and the solid waste management hierarchy (SWMH) model proposed by McAllister, (2015). The study will elucidate on a ground level practical approach to solve solid waste management issue in Sri Lanka.
